OO-1593: fix some validation errors in qTI 2.1 editor if the user don't click...
OO-1593: fix some validation errors in qTI 2.1 editor if the user don't click the save button once, add unit tests to check that our item builders generate valid items to start with...
Showing
- src/main/java/org/olat/ims/qti21/model/xml/AssessmentHtmlBuilder.java 11 additions, 1 deletion...a/org/olat/ims/qti21/model/xml/AssessmentHtmlBuilder.java
- src/main/java/org/olat/ims/qti21/model/xml/AssessmentItemBuilder.java 1 addition, 6 deletions...a/org/olat/ims/qti21/model/xml/AssessmentItemBuilder.java
- src/main/java/org/olat/ims/qti21/model/xml/AssessmentItemFactory.java 9 additions, 0 deletions...a/org/olat/ims/qti21/model/xml/AssessmentItemFactory.java
- src/main/java/org/olat/ims/qti21/model/xml/interactions/EssayAssessmentItemBuilder.java 6 additions, 0 deletions...21/model/xml/interactions/EssayAssessmentItemBuilder.java
- src/main/java/org/olat/ims/qti21/model/xml/interactions/KPrimAssessmentItemBuilder.java 15 additions, 2 deletions...21/model/xml/interactions/KPrimAssessmentItemBuilder.java
- src/test/java/org/olat/ims/qti21/model/xml/AssessmentHtmlBuilderTest.java 9 additions, 10 deletions...g/olat/ims/qti21/model/xml/AssessmentHtmlBuilderTest.java
- src/test/java/org/olat/ims/qti21/model/xml/AssessmentItemBuilderTest.java 1 addition, 1 deletion...g/olat/ims/qti21/model/xml/AssessmentItemBuilderTest.java
- src/test/java/org/olat/ims/qti21/model/xml/AssessmentItemPackageTest.java 167 additions, 272 deletions...g/olat/ims/qti21/model/xml/AssessmentItemPackageTest.java
- src/test/java/org/olat/ims/qti21/model/xml/Auswahlaufgabe_1509468352.xml 2 additions, 0 deletions...rg/olat/ims/qti21/model/xml/Auswahlaufgabe_1509468352.xml
- src/test/java/org/olat/ims/qti21/model/xml/Hotspotaufgabe_478898401.xml 2 additions, 0 deletions...org/olat/ims/qti21/model/xml/Hotspotaufgabe_478898401.xml
- src/test/java/org/olat/ims/qti21/model/xml/OnyxToQtiAssessementItemsTest.java 127 additions, 0 deletions...at/ims/qti21/model/xml/OnyxToQtiAssessementItemsTest.java
- src/test/java/org/olat/ims/qti21/model/xml/Task_1597435347.xml 41 additions, 0 deletions...est/java/org/olat/ims/qti21/model/xml/Task_1597435347.xml
- src/test/java/org/olat/test/AllTestsJunit4.java 1 addition, 0 deletionssrc/test/java/org/olat/test/AllTestsJunit4.java
Loading
Please register or sign in to comment